I respectfully disagree, though your argument is sound if you don't have the right setup and are comparing them to chickens. If you brood ducklings outside, a secure grow out pen, and have a good landscape for them (say, a little creek and pond), they are the easiest animals ever. I also love how much they poop. I clean out their pen every spring and apply all that good stuff directly to my garden. Their poo isn't hot like chickens so you don't need to compost it for a year before using.
